S. Y. Set S. Yamashita K. Hsu K. H. Fong Y. Inoue K. Sato D. Tanaka M. Jablonski

A fiber pulsed laser with a 1cm cavity length and a 10GHz fundamental repetition-rate is demonstrated using a carbon nanotube-based mode-locker deposited within the laser cavity. This is the shortest fiber mode-locked laser ever reported to date.

A Ankiewicz Wenjing Chen P St Russell M Taki N Akhmediev

In the fiber fuse, a pulse of high temperature travels toward the input end of the fiber, where high-power laser light is launched into the fiber. At any point along the fiber, the soliton can be ignited. The fiber core is damaged in the process so that light cannot propagate beyond the hot spot.
